Meghan Markle sweetly revealed that her daughter likes to “sway a little bit” when she enjoys a food that she is eating.
Joined by Korean-American chef Roy Choi in episode three of her new series, With Love, Meghan, the 43-year-old was given a piece of traditional kimchi that Roy was helping her make.
When Roy held out a piece in her direction, she asked, “Is that for me to try?”
After taking a small bite, Meghan eats the entire piece in one go before signalling that she enjoyed it with a swaying motion.
Speaking of three-year-old Princess Lilibet, Meghan then told Roy: “It’s good. My daughter [Lilibet] does the same.
“When she likes what she’s eating, she sways a little bit.”
Taking to her Instagram, just hours before the episodes aired on Netflix, Meghan shared a picture of flowers and a sweet handwritten card that she received from Prince Harry and their two children, Prince Archie, five, and Lilibet – who is sweetly known as Lili.
The note, handwritten on pink paper, read: “Congratulations Mumma! We love your show, and we love you! Lili, Archie [and] Papa xxx.”
